Rover fuel pump problems
 
Hello CF

Any help here wouldn't go a miss...

I got a 1999 rover 420, diesel, it has fuel in it and I can prime/pump right up to the fuel pump but after the fuel pump there's nothing but when I put the ignition in the start position it seems to be ticking away fine, or sounds no different now from when I bought it, it's almost if the pump itself is blocked.

Does anyone have any thought's ?
